Process for Advanced Management of End of Life of Aircraft With the increasing number of retired aircraft – more than an estimated 6,000 within the next twenty years – the safe management of their end of life, both in terms of the environment and public health, has become a crucial issue. The PAMELA project demonstrated the possibility of recycling up to 85% of plane components, a significant advance on the earlier rate of 60%. These activities were carried out in response to the high number of planes that will be retired within the next few years and its environmental and economic impact. While the “smart and safe dismantling” method used during the project was simple, it had to respect the aircraft as well as the environment, health and safety (EHS) regulations.

A trailblazing solution for point-to-point air cargo transportation For the first time in history, an aircraft, the LCA60T, will load and unload up to 60 tonnes of heavy or bulky loads in hover flight. As the market for renewable power rapidly expands, an industry-wide need is emerging for cost-effective and sustainable transport to difficult- to-access location.
  7. 7. Eurohab Peter WEISS and Jean-Jacques FAVIER, two of the co-founders of Spartan Space, developed the EuroHab concept, an inflatable habitat for missions on the surface of Moon or Mars. Late 2020, the EuroHab concept won the “Lunar village” special mention at the Jacques Rougerie Foundation – Institut de France International Architecture Competition. Following this award, a scaled prototype of the habitat was selected to be exhibited in the French pavilion during Expo 2020 Dubai.

Connected forest This project consists of developing and testing in a real situation a prototype of a network for measuring and monitoring forest ecosystems based on a set of in situ sensors, including an on-board telecommunications system and a computer system for processing, visualization and monitoring. interactivity with data.

  10. 10. Drone center of excellence and testing for health, logistics and biodiversity uses The first drone factory for civilian use in French vanilla islands in the Cambaie area in Saint-Paul. This R&D unit for manufacturing unmanned aircraft was detected and incubated at Réunion Island Tech Park. Fly-R, operating under the Aéro Composites Innovation label, aims to design a complete range of drones for maritime and land surveillance. Real opportunities lie ahead across Vanilla French Islands

Indian Ocean Aerotech : air transport recycling and maintenance center Currently, there are no procedures for decommissioning aircraft in safe and environmentally responsible conditions (e.g. existing End of Life vehicle (ELV) rules are not aircraft specific). Hence, the project’s objectives were threefold. First, it would demonstrate, by full-scale experimentation on aircraft's, that 85- 95% of their components – instead of the most business practices that allow only for recovery rates of 60%, mostly of aluminium, the other materials being eliminated – can be easily recycled, reused or recovered. Second, the project would set up a new standard for safe and environmentally friendly management of End of Life Aircraft (ELA). It would cover the entire process, from storage at the pre-decommissioning phase, disassembling and dismantling, to the recycling or elimination of the materials. Finally, the project would launch a European network that is able to further disseminate the dismantling process.
